I don’t know much about the company Vacavaliente, other than they make really great sculptural toys from leather. Each toy is handmade in Argentina from eco-friendly reconstituted leather. Each one also serves a useful purpose, such as pen holders or piggy banks. Love it!

Continuing my obsession with everyday objects that are not quite as the seem, the crumple cup (below) is such a fun little find. Many of you might remember the Lucky Beggar cup (they also make a Lucky Beggar coin purse). Known by generations as the iconic New York City paper coffee cup, the Lucky Beggar makes us all feel a little bit nostalgic with its “We are happy to serve you” message accross the front.
My newest find is the crumpled cup, available at the MOMA store. What looks like a wrinkled little plastic picnic cup is instead a sturdy white porcelain beauty that would be fun to use for just about anything. Get the set of three and have some crumpled coffee with two of your closest friends. ($35)
